King got out because he saw the writing on the wall. He saw what happened in PA. He saw what happened in VA.

He knows his district use to be heavily Republican and Conservative, and he use to win his elections by double digits, but in last years election he beat a totally unknown Dem by only 6% points..

20+ years ago in Nassau County, 1 of the counties in his district, Republicans outnumbered the Democrats, 360,000 to 257,000. In 2019 the number of Democrats is now 411,000. The number of Republicans is 330,000.

Rep. Pete King, longtime N.Y. congressman, latest in slew of GOP retirements

Longtime Rep. Pete King, R-N.Y., announced Monday he will retire from Congress at the end of his term.

"I have decided not to be a candidate for re-election to Congress in 2020," King, 75, said in a statement. "I made this decision after much discussion with my wife Rosemary; my son Sean; and my daughter Erin. The prime reason for my decision was that after 28 years of spending 4 days a week in Washington, D.C., it is time to end the weekly commute and be home in Seaford."​
